  • A manhunt remains underway for Robert Card, who opened fire at a bowling alley and a bar in Lewiston on Wednesday, killing 18 people and injuring 13 more. Tracy Walder says he could've killed himself, fled on foot, fled by boat or fled by another waiting vehicle.
